#1b3c50 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1b3c50 is composed of 10.6% red, 23.5%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.3% cyan, 25%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 202.6 degrees, a saturation of 49.5% and a lightness of 21%. #1b3c50 color hex could be obtained by blending #3678a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

Shades and Tints of #1b3c50
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020507 is the darkest color, while #f7fafc is the lightest one.
